SMEC Australia Pty Ltd is a multi-disciplinary infrastructure consulting firm operating across Australia with global connections spanning more than 40 countries. The firm provides engineering, environmental, and planning services for major infrastructure projects, with heritage tracing back to the Snowy Mountains Hydroelectric Scheme. SMEC Australia operates through specialist teams that deliver technical solutions for transport, energy, water, urban development, and environmental projects.
The practice prepares master plans, feasibility studies, and strategic development frameworks for complex infrastructure systems. Services include transport planning and advisory work for roads, bridges, highways, rail networks, and metro systems. The firm carries out airport and aero city master planning, terminal design, and aviation infrastructure development. Infrastructure planning services extend to port facilities, coastal management, and intermodal transport connections.
SMEC Australia specialises in environmental planning services that support infrastructure development under the Environmental Planning and Assessment Act 1979. The firm prepares environmental impact assessments, sustainability frameworks, and climate resilience strategies for major projects. Water infrastructure planning encompasses stormwater management, wastewater systems, water supply solutions, and water sensitive urban design approaches.
